Vegan BBQ Buffalo Seitan Chicken

This method uses the washed flour method, meaning you make a simple flour and water dough, let it rest, then wash the dough in water to remove the starch. Whats left is the wheat protein called seitan.

Watch how to make this from beginning to end in the video. One recipe makes between 10-12 pieces, and each person will eat on average 2-3 pieces, so double the recipe according to the number of guests you are having.

Dough:
The dough recipe is very simple. 2 parts flour to 1 part water.
10 cups bread flour (Approximately 3/4 of a 5 lb bag of flour)
5 cups hot or boiling water
Knead together to make a firm dough. Place the dough ball in a bowl and pour water to cover. Place a plate, lid or cloth over the bowl and allow to rest from 6 hours to overnight.

Wash:
Knead the dough in the water until it falls apart in the water. Strain out the seitan from the starch water. Place the strained seitan back into the bowl and pour over with fresh water. Knead again for a few minutes. The water will still be opaque. Strain again and replace with fresh water for a third wash. Again knead the dough in the water for a few minutes. The water should be transparent but still a little cloudy. Now the washing is done.

Form the seitan chicken pieces:
Massage 2 tablespoons chickpea flour and 1 tablespoon of seasoned salt into the seitan. Let rest for a few minutes while you get a clean work space ready.

Cut or tear the seitan into 4 inch pieces. Tie a knot in each piece, then wrap the ends around a craft stick, cinnamon stick or sugar cane stick as shown in the video to resemble a drumstick or wing. Repeat until all the chicken pieces have been formed.

Make the skin:
2 cups flour mixed with 1 cup water. Knead to make a dough. This dough will not be washed in water. Flour a work surface and roll out the dough into a thin layer. Cut the dough in wedges to make the skin for the drumsticks, and cut the dough in rectangles for the other chicken pieces. Wrap each piece in a thin layer of dough skin.

Cook the seitan until golden brown:
Coat both sides of each piece generously with flour. Then brown both sides in a thin layer of hot oil until browned. Work in batches if necessary to avoid crowding the pan until all are cooked.

Return the browned seitan back to a large dutch oven, pot, or baking dish. Pour the BBQ buffalo sauce over the seitan pieces and simmer for 30-40 minutes until the sauce is thick and coats each piece. Add a little more water if necessary to avoid burning.

BBQ Buffalo Sauce recipe:
2 cups water
2 cups BBQ sauce
1 cup either Frank's RedHot sauce or Sriracha chili sauce for an Asian flavor.
